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54085638 263 7948706 42 00689297129
896027533 8466 6816
896027533 8466 6816
5536350 8076016 65207 78
All about undefined
Interested in learning more?
896027533 8466 6816
5536350 8076016 65207 78
See more
7961477 54
152 83718282 05
See more
1221560885 129 318522
0170987876 642444901 39049435 8573874
See more